Overview

Extended detection and response (XDR) is a natural extension of the endpoint detection and response (EDR) concept, in which behaviors that occur after threat prevention controls act are further inspected for potentially malicious, suspicious, or risky activity that warrant mitigation. The difference is simply the location (endpoint or beyond) where the behaviors occur. XDR solutions are increasingly popular as organizations recognize the inefficiencies, and in many cases ineffectiveness, of security infrastructures comprised of many individual “best-of-breed” security products deployed from different vendors over time. Common challenges arising from this point-product approach include:

  • Gaps in security: with each product operating in its own silo, opportunities often arise for cyberattacks to enter in between
  • Too much security information: with each product generating individual alerts and other information, security teams can easily miss indicators of cyberattacks
  • Uncoordinated response: with each product operating independently, it falls on the human operator to share information and coordinate response actions 

Based on these experiences, many organizations are looking to consolidate security vendors and products in favor of integrated solution sets.
